No therapeutic intervention is applied.",[9],[21],{"name":22,"role":23,"phone":24,"phoneExt":10,"email":25},"Mahmoud Abdallah Mahmoud, lecturer of urology","CONTACT","01155361979","mahmoud.abdalla@med.bsu.edu.eg",[27],{"facility":28,"status":29,"city":30,"state":31,"zip":32,"country":33,"countryCode":34,"cosmosGeoPoint":35,"geoPoint":40,"contacts":41},"Beni Suef university hospital","RECRUITING","Banī Suwayf","Beni Suef Governorate","62511","Egypt","EG",{"type":36,"coordinates":37},"Point",[38,39],31.09785,29.07441,{"lat":39,"lon":38},[42],{"name":43,"role":23,"phone":44,"phoneExt":10,"email":45},"doaa mahmoud khalil, lecturer","01152091011","drm_abdaalah_88@yahoo.com",{"type":47,"investigatorFullName":48,"investigatorTitle":49,"investigatorAffiliation":5,"oldNameTitle":10,"oldOrganization":10},"PRINCIPAL_INVESTIGATOR","Mahmoud Abdallah","lecturer of urology","100635069","shear-wave-elastography-for-evaluation-of-hydronephrosis-in-pregnancy-100635069",false,"NCT07547891","Shear Wave Elastography for Evaluation of Hydronephrosis in Pregnancy","Renal Cortical Stiffness Measured by Shear Wave Elastography for Evaluation of Hydronephrosis in Pregnancy: A Prospective Study","* Inclusion Criteria:\n\n  * Pregnant women ≥12 weeks gestation with Loin Pain.\n  * Sonographic evidence of hydronephrosis.\n  * Age ≥18 years.\n  * Provided informed consent\n* Exclusion Criteria:\n\n  * Chronic kidney disease (CKD).\n  * Congenital renal anomalies.\n  * Pre-eclampsia\n  * Poor acoustic window.\n  * Contraindication to examination position.","FEMALE","18 Years",{"count":60,"type":61},250,"ESTIMATED","OBSERVATIONAL","Hydronephrosis is common during pregnancy and is often physiological; however, it may also result from true obstruction requiring intervention. Differentiating between physiological and obstructive hydronephrosis remains a clinical challenge using conventional ultrasound.\n\nThis prospective observational study aims to evaluate the diagnostic accuracy of renal cortical stiffness measured by shear wave elastography (SWE) in differentiating obstructive from physiological hydronephrosis in pregnant women. Participants presenting with hydronephrosis will undergo clinical assessment, laboratory investigations, and ultrasound evaluation including SWE measurements.\n\nThe diagnostic performance of SWE will be assessed using receiver operating characteristic (ROC) analysis, and optimal cut-off values will be determined. The study aims to provide a safe, non-invasive, and quantitative tool to improve diagnosis and guide management in pregnant patients with hydronephrosis.",[65,66],"Hydronephrosis","Pregnancy","2026-04-22",{"date":69,"type":70},"2026-04-27","ACTUAL",{"date":72,"type":70},"2026-04-07",{"date":74,"type":61},"2027-04",{"name":5,"class":6},1]
